A managed 'stead-wide network would be benificial to all living aboard. Having everyone on one (highly-secured) network would simplify all intra-seastead communications. With a satelite link to the outside, all residents or guests would have an internet connection. Throught the use of wifi (or wimax) technology thoughout, along with wifi-based phones there would be no need to depend on the outragously high prices charged by off-shore cellular carriers, which I have seen as much as $10/min or more.
Once the infrastructure was in place, the network itself would have relatively low overhead costs. Just the costs of maintanence and upgrades. The satelite link itself, for the internet, would be the expensive part. This would be the one part that would have to be negotiated to make it cost-effective.
